§ 155.093  PORTABLE TRAILER SIGNS AND SIGNBOARDS.
   (A)   Size limitations.  Portable trailer signs or signboards shall not exceed 50 square feet in area.
   (B)   Temporary use only.  Trailer signs and signboards shall not be located in a residential district for period exceeding 48 hours in any 6-month period or in a nonresidential district for a period exceeding 10 days in any 6-month period.
   (C)   Lighted portable signs.  Lighted portable trailer signs shall require both an electrical and sign permit.  The signs may not project over the public right-of-way, nor include flashing lights or lights that may be confused with traffic or emergency lights.  They may not be allowed projector lamps, inside silvered lamps, or exterior exposed lamps.  The signs must also be labeled by a recognized testing laboratory and shall include a ground fault interrupter (GFI) device.
